The MM3Z3V0C is a surface-mount Zener diode manufactured by Fairchild (now part of onsemi), designed to provide precise voltage regulation at 3V with a 5% tolerance in a compact SOD-323F package. This discrete semiconductor component falls within the Diodes - Zener - Single category and serves as a unidirectional voltage reference and protection device capable of dissipating up to 200 mW of power.
This Zener diode addresses critical design challenges in modern electronics where space constraints and reliable voltage regulation are paramount. The SOD-323F (SC-90) package offers an extremely small footprint ideal for high-density PCB layouts while maintaining robust performance across an extended operating temperature range of -65°C to 150°C, making it suitable for harsh environmental conditions. The device features a nominal Zener voltage of 3V with a maximum impedance of 89 Ohms at the test current, ensuring stable voltage regulation. Its forward voltage drop is specified at 1V maximum when conducting 10 mA, while reverse leakage current remains minimal at 9 µA when subjected to 1V reverse bias, demonstrating excellent blocking characteristics.

MM3Z3V0C Features
The MM3Z3V0C is a single Zener diode devices characterized by a nominal Zener voltage of 3V, with a tolerance of ±5%, ensuring steady and precise voltage regulation. It accommodates a maximum power dissipation of 200 mW, suitable for low-power circuit designs. Thanks to its low forward voltage (maximum 1V at 10mA) and low reverse leakage (9µA at 1V), it ensures energy efficiency and minimal standby power loss. With a maximum dynamic impedance of 89 Ohms, it provides enhanced voltage stabilization under varying load conditions. The device is constructed for unidirectional functionality, which is particularly favorable for circuits needing precise one-way voltage clamping. Its wide operating temperature range from -65°C to 150°C ensures reliable performance even in harsh industrial and automotive environments.
